Reposted by Quinntronics
london.gov.uk
I’m deeply concerned about recent racist attacks in our capital city.
From the TfL workers being punched and racially abused to women who were chased down the street - I’m deeply concerned about the alarming rise of racist attacks in our capital city. 
 
We are also seeing appalling incidents elsewhere in the country - some of which have included abhorrent violence towards children.
 
These incidents illustrate the dangers of allowing racism to be normalised and mainstreamed. Real lives and personal safety are under threat.
 
I will continue to speak out against racial inequalities and injustices, as well as providing support to organisations working to support our communities and bring people together.
 
London is a successful, liberal and multicultural city. The greatest in the world. It will always be for everyone and I promise you: that will never change.

MAYOR OF LONDON, SADIQ KHAN
